El Crucero weather in January

In January, El Crucero sees average daytime highs of 31°C and overnight lows near 22°C, with 4 mm of rain across 0.9 wet days and about 11.4 hours of daylight. It is the 5th-warmest and 11th-wettest month of the year here.

Day-to-day highs hold fairly steady near 31°C through the month. The sky is clear or mostly clear about 75% of the time in January, and the air most often feels muggy.

Daylight stretches from about 11 h 18 min at the start of January to 11 h 30 min by month's end. Set against the rest of the year, January is El Crucero's 3rd-clearest and 2nd-windiest month. For the whole year in context, see El Crucero's year-round climate.

Location & terrain

Where is El Crucero?

El Crucero sits at 12.0°N, 86.3°W, 930 m above sea level, in Nicaragua. The nearest listed city is San Marcos, 15 km away.

Topography around El Crucero

How much the land rises and falls, and what covers it, within 3, 16 and 80 km of El Crucero.

Within 3 km, the terrain around El Crucero has significant vari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 305 m around an average of 808 m above sea level; within 16 km, large vari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 889 m; within 80 km, very significant vari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 1,305 m.

The land around El Crucero is covered by trees (95%) within 3 km, trees (81%) within 16 km, and water (40%), trees (32%) and grassland (21%) within 80 km.
